Description: Myocoptes musculinus is a common ectoparasite of wild mice and occasionally found on laboratory mice. Infections in laboratory mice are often subclinical but can cause severe dermatitis. More importantly, however, infections can cause unwanted immunological effects that may alter research outcomes, and most animal facilities strive to prevent or eliminate the presence of mites from research mouse colonies.
